Business & Legal Affairs CoordinatorThis role requires exceptional attention to detail, great organizational skills and the ability juggle mult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ment in order to meet critical deadlines. As this position will deal with senior executives inside and outside the company, a high level of integrity and professionalism is essential. Additionally, the individual must be proficient in Outlook and Excel and have the ability to partner successfully with the entire team.This is an ideal opportunity for a recent law school graduate looking to break into the competitive world of entertainment business and legal affairs. Once acclimated (6-9 months), the candidate will begin (in addition to continuing to handle the administrative duties) spearheading special business and development projects, drafting and negotiating deals. Training will be under the direct supervision of the head of the department. It is anticipated that this position will be a two year commitment and, in success, will prepare the candidate for a career in the Companys business & legal affairs department.**Essential Functions**:- Coordinate departmental and inter-departmental communications- Track the flow of all requests coming into the department, updating status changes on master spreadsheet- Track work flow of deal requests and high priority on Department board.- Coordinate and organize a busy calendar - including but not limited to sending detailed calendar invites, anticipating schedule adjustments, and coordinating internal/external meetings and appointments by managing correspondence with other offices and distributing necessary information/materials- Manage active work files- Receive calls, take messages and route correspondence, run calls, maintain call log- Make travel arrangements- Prepare expense reports- Maintain contacts- Manage Incoming e-mail- Receive invoices, research payment obligations, prepare check requests and submit them for approval- Scan and electronically file documents- As directed by Director, Business & Legal Affairs, process and record payments- Special projects as they arise**Requirements**Requirements**:- Recent graduate of an ABA accredited law school- Admitted to California Bar- Demonstrated interest in the entertainment industry preferable- Must be a self-motivated and proactive with a proven ability to work in a fast-paced, environment- Proficient knowledge of MS Office (Excel, Word, and Outlook)- Please note that candidates who are qualified for this position will be requested to complete an employment pre-screening test. A background check will be required of any candidate who is offered the position.
